The Backyard

Two neighbors share a fence line and a slow, mutual unease. When the porch light begins to flicker on its own, one of them starts keeping watch — and discovers that the man staring back from the dark keeps his exact face. Shot on vintage glass, ‘The Backyard’ is a study of paranoia at the edge of the domestic: the place where the lawn ends and something else begins.
